Jumpstart for Young Children, Inc.

More than twenty years ago, four college students asked each other: What if we could offer children from under-resourced communities individualized attention before they enter kindergarten, giving them the critical academic and social skills—the ‘jumpstart’—they need to succeed? The idea took hold and today Jumpstart has trained more than 45,000 college students and community volunteers, preparing nearly 100,000 children for kindergarten success. Jumpstart’s program is replicated across the country in 14 states and the District of Columbia. We leverage partnerships with higher education institutions, community organizations, Head Start programs, community-based preschools, and school districts to create sustainable solutions in order to close the kindergarten readiness gap.

Citizen Schools

Citizen Schools' mission is to close the opportunity and achievement gap by expanding the learning day and engaging students in real-world learning, ensuring that all children graduate high school ready to succeed in college and careers. In partnerships with school districts, Citizen Schools increases students’ total learning time by 35-40%. Its year-long academic enrichment program creates a powerful culture of achievement school-wide, and effectively builds bridges between schools, parents and community members. Girl Scout Council Of The Nation's Capital

The council delivers the Girl Scout Leadership Experience to girls across Washington, D.C., and nearby Maryland, Virginia and West Virginia counties—running troop programs, camps, community-service and outdoor education to develop leadership, confidence, and practical skills. The council also supports volunteers and families and provides services (e.g., camps, shops, financial assistance) to expand access.
